The Bible tells us that God gives everyone a measure of faith. It also says faith is like a muscle that needs to be developed. The level of faith that we were given by God is the starting point of our faith; not the destination.

Romans 12:6 We have different gifts, according to the grace given us. If a man’s gift is prophesying, let him use it in proportion to his faith.

As I go to minister this weekend, I was asking God to give me clarity in the prophetic. I want the words God gives through me to bring encouragement and blessing. I want people to know that God cares for them personally and deeply. So my prayer was God help me to hear clearly from you. This is a good prayer and a prayer I know God will honour because of His love for His people.

But this passage came to my mind and I felt challenged. In this verse it says those with the gift of prophecy should prophesy in proportion to his faith. I felt that a better prayer was “Lord increase my faith!” If I prophesy in proportion to my faith and my faith and trust in God increases, than the flow-on affect will be that the gifts that God has given me will increase.

The same is true for you. God has given you gifts. Some of you need to discover your gifts but don’t believe the lie that says you don’t have any. There are too many clear scriptures that say God has given everyone gifts for the benefit of the Body (see scriptures below). As you move in your gifts, ask God to increase your faith. You need to stir it up. You need to be ruthless with doubt and fear. You need to take God at His Word. You need to trust and obey. As your faith increases, your gift expression will also increase and it’s all for the glory of God and the furtherance of His Kingdom.
